A member asked:

I think i might've seriously injured my knuckle. i slammed it against a brick wall and it was bruised for weeks and keep getting severely bruised. it feels moved to the left and juts inward.

2 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

You may have: a Boxer's fracture, otherwise known as metacarpal fracture. Your pinky knuckle is most likely to be injured, but any one of those knuckles could be fractured and displaced, which would explain abnormal movement and indentation. I would see a hand Orthopedist to get properly diagnosed and/or repaired. If left untended to, once scar tissue sets in your knuckle/joint would be permanently deformed.
